Analysis

In 2023, persistence to grade 5, total in Kiribati stood at 89.7%.

The figure is up 8.1% on the previous year and up 2.4% over five years.

Over the whole period, persistence to grade 5, total in Kiribati peaked at 95.4% in 1996 and was at its lowest, 71.9%, in 2001.

Kiribati ranks 93rd of 164 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

Persistence to grade 5 (percentage of cohort reaching grade 5) is the share of children enrolled in the first grade of primary school who eventually reach grade 5. The estimate is based on the reconstructed cohort method.
